Investing for the Future: SM Foundation empowers the dreams of 33 College Freshmen scholars

Must read

BATANGAS City — THIRTY-THREE (33) college freshmen from various areas in Batangas were awarded scholarships by SM Foundation in a ceremony held at SM City Batangas, Monday, August 4

The awarding ceremony attended by SM Foundation representatives and officials from SM City Batangas and SM Store Batangas, was a significant milestone for the aspiring students, who were accompanied by their proud parents as they participated in the orientation and contract signing at the mall’s Event Hub.

In his welcome message, SM City Batangas Assistant Mall Manager Bernard Coronel extended his congratulations to the scholars and their families.

“You are here not just because of your academic excellence, but because of your resilience, your determination and your unwavering belief in the power of education to transform lives.” he said. As SM Scholars, you carry with you the legacy of a program built on the vision of uplifting Filipino youth through education. “

Highlighting the impact of the program, an SM scholar alumnus, Richard Amante, SM Store Batangas Manager, Personal Shopper 2 shared also an inspiring message during the event.

“SM didn’t just give me an education and a job — it gave me a home, a family, and a future,” the alumnus shared. ” Trust your process, work with your heart, and believe in what you can become. Because dreams do come true. I’m a living proof.”

The scholarship provides full tuition coverage, monthly allowances, and access to various activities and opportunities designed to support academic and professional development. These include assemblies, part-time work during school breaks, on-the-job training, and employment opportunities within the SM Group after graduation.

The Scholarship Program, established in 1993 by the SM Group founder Henry Sy Sr., aims to make education accessible and to support the development of future professionals through structured support and long term opportunities, enabling scholars to uplift their families and contribute meaningfully to their communities. It has now supported over 6,000 scholars across the country.|
